turbina

turbine

noun toor-BEE-nah Rare

Origin: Latin turbo (spinning top, whirlwind)

Usage Note

Turbina refers to any rotary engine driven by a fluid (steam, water, gas, wind): turbina de vapor (steam turbine), turbina eólica (wind turbine). The adjective turbinado (turbinated) belongs to a separate anatomical or botanical sense. It is always feminine and forms a regular plural turbinas.

Examples

"La turbina genera electricidad con la fuerza del agua."

Natural Translation

The turbine generates electricity with the force of water.
